# Rotary documentation

Rotary is the product name for the MPL-2.0 agent harness crate and CLI. The Rust crate and executable are both named `rx4`; use `rx4`, not `rotary`, in terminal commands.

## Command contract

```bash
rx4 chat
rx4 exec "fix the failing test"
rx4 serve /tmp/rx4.sock
rx4 doctor
rx4 models
rx4 tools
```

Product hosts own scheduling and user experience. telekinesis owns pi protocol compatibility; Omi Desktop owns its desktop UI, local data policy, and provider-specific OAuth path.
